According to Stratistics MRC, the Global Automotive Films Market is accounted for $7.43 billion in 2023 and is expected to reach $13.9 billion by 2030 growing at a CAGR of 9.4% during the forecast period. Automotive films are specialized, thin coatings or layers applied to various surfaces of vehicles. These films are designed to enhance the performance, appearance, and functionality of different vehicle components. Ceramic automotive films and other heat-rejecting films reduce interior heat build up by blocking infrared rays, enhancing comfort for occupants, and reducing the need for excessive air conditioning.

Market Dynamics:

Driver:

Rising demand for vehicle customization

Vehicle owners are increasingly seeking ways to personalize and enhance the appearance of their vehicles. Automotive films provide a layer of protection for the vehicle's original paint. These films act as a barrier against scratches, rock chips, and other minor damages, preserving the vehicle's exterior and maintaining its value. Moreover, automotive films offer a reversible modification option. Unlike permanent alterations such as painting, automotive films can be easily removed or replaced, allowing vehicle owners to change their vehicle's appearance whenever they desire.

Restraint:

Quality concerns

Quality concerns pose a notable restraint in the automotive film market, impacting consumer trust and hindering widespread adoption. Low-quality films may fail to provide the promised UV protection, heat rejection, or longevity, compromising the value proposition for consumers. However, consumers may hesitate to invest in automotive films due to fears of purchasing inferior products that do not meet their expectations. These factors hamper market expansion.

Opportunity:

Technological advancements

Continuous innovation in film technologies has led to the development of products with enhanced functionalities, durability, and performance. Films with embedded sensors, responsive to environmental conditions, contribute to adaptive functionalities such as automatic tint adjustments based on sunlight intensity. This not only enhances the user experience but also aligns with the broader trend of smart and connected vehicles. Therefore, technological innovations are a significant factor accelerating the market demand.

Threat:

Installation complexity

Installing automotive films is a delicate process. Even minor errors during installation, such as bubbles, creases, or contamination, can compromise the film's appearance and performance. Poorly installed films can damage an organization's image and bottom line by resulting in warranty claims and unhappy customers. The business needs skilled labourers with film application training and experience to install automotive films correctly. These factors hamper market growth.

The paint protection flims segment is expected to be the largest during the forecast period

The paint protection flims segment is estimated to hold the largest share. Paint Protection Films (PPF) plays a crucial role in automotive film, providing advanced protection to vehicle exteriors. These transparent polyurethane films are applied to the painted surfaces of automobiles, forming a durable shield against road debris, stone chips, bug splatter, and harsh weather conditions. The primary purpose of PPF is to prevent scratches, swirl marks, and other minor damages that can degrade the appearance and value of a vehicle.

The ceramic segment is expected to have the highest CAGR during the forecast period

The ceramic segment is anticipated to have lucrative growth during the forecast period. The ceramic technology enables these films to effectively block infrared rays, minimizing interior heat build up and creating a more comfortable driving experience. The high-tech composition also ensures exceptional optical clarity, preserving the true colors of the vehicle's interior while reducing glare for improved visibility. Furthermore, ceramic automotive films contribute to energy efficiency by reducing the need for air conditioning, thereby enhancing fuel efficiency in vehicles.

Region with largest share:

Asia Pacific commanded the largest market share during the extrapolated period due to the rising automotive industry, increasing consumer awareness, and a surge in aftermarket customization. Rising awareness of energy efficiency and environmental sustainability propels the adoption of films designed to reduce solar heat, contributing to fuel efficiency and a decreased reliance on air conditioning. Moreover, the region experiences high solar radiation levels, making automotive films crucial for mitigating heat and protecting occupants from harmful UV rays.

Region with highest CAGR:

North America is expected to witness profitable growth over the projection period, owing to the strong presence of the automotive industry. The region is home to several major automobile manufacturers, including General Motors, Ford, and Fiat Chrysler Automobiles. The robust automotive manufacturing sector leads to a high demand for automotive films for various applications such as window tinting, paint protection, and wraps. Additionally, the presence of a large aftermarket industry further boosts the demand for automotive films in North America.

Key Developments:

In June 2023, Toray Industries, Inc. developed a high heat-insulating solar control film PICASUS for advanced mobility applications. The film helped the company's innovative nano-multilayer technology to deliver a transparency that is comparable to that of glass. It also offers world-class thermal insulation from the sun's infrared rays.

In February 2023, Eastman Chemical Company acquired Ai-Red Technology (Dalian) Co., Ltd., a manufacturer and supplier of paint protection and window film for auto and architectural markets in the Asia Pacific region. The acquisition helped Eastman Chemical Company to increase its presence in China and enhance its earning strength.
